Last Sunday’s letters were stridently anti-French.

They usually begin pouring, in an almost Freudian manner of hysteria, whenever that country makes a show of its own independence and sovereignty.

I wonder if those who write them ever had night bombers fly overhead with what is euphemistically referred as “ordnance” aboard. I did. French President Francis Mitterrand did. It is our private recurring nightmare.

MADELEINE KAZAN

Pacific Palisades
